{"id":1000672,"date":"2026-08-14T17:24:25","date_gmt":"2026-08-14T17:24:25","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/1000672\/"},"modified":"2026-08-14T17:24:25","modified_gmt":"2026-08-14T17:24:25","slug":"jacksonville-ranked-one-of-the-uss-most-dangerous-cities-for-pedestrians","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/1000672\/","title":{"rendered":"Jacksonville ranked one of the US&#8217;s most dangerous cities for pedestrians"},"content":{"rendered":"<p class=\"default__StyledText-sc-tl066j-0 eJzHXc body-paragraph\">ORLANDO, Fla. \u2014 A Florida city has been ranked as one of the most dangerous places in the country for pedestrians in a new analysis.<\/p>\n<p class=\"default__StyledText-sc-tl066j-0 eJzHXc body-paragraph\">Jacksonville ranked No. 34 among 35 major U.S. cities studied by footwear company KURU. Only Albuquerque, New Mexico, received a lower pedestrian safety score.<\/p>\n<p class=\"default__StyledText-sc-tl066j-0 eJzHXc body-paragraph\">The analysis gave Jacksonville a pedestrian fatality rate of 3.05 deaths per 100,000 people and a Walk Score of 26. Its overall pedestrian safety score was 20 out of 100.<\/p>\n<p class=\"default__StyledText-sc-tl066j-0 eJzHXc body-paragraph\">Albuquerque ranked last with an overall score of 12, while Boston topped the list with a score of 88.<\/p>\n<p>How the cities were ranked<\/p>\n<p class=\"default__StyledText-sc-tl066j-0 eJzHXc body-paragraph\">The analysis combined pedestrian fatality data from the Governors Highway Safety Association\u2019s preliminary 2024 report with Walk Score data measuring access to amenities, population density and street design.<\/p>\n<p class=\"default__StyledText-sc-tl066j-0 eJzHXc body-paragraph\">Cities received up to 50 points for pedestrian fatality rates and up to 50 points for walkability.<\/p>\n<p class=\"default__StyledText-sc-tl066j-0 eJzHXc body-paragraph\">The company examined 35 metro areas with populations exceeding 500,000.
